What Keeps You Alive (2018) is a tense psychological thriller about love, trust, and the hidden darkness within relationships. The story follows a married couple celebrating their anniversary at a remote cabin, where what begins as a romantic getaway quickly turns into a terrifying fight for survival.

The emotional tone is intense, claustrophobic, and unpredictable. The film builds tension through isolation and shifting power dynamics, where trust is slowly replaced by fear. The relationship at the center becomes the source of danger, creating a disturbing contrast between intimacy and threat.

The film explores themes of deception, identity, and control, showing how well we truly know the person we love. What Keeps You Alive stands out for its sharp twists and emotional intensity, leaving viewers with a lingering sense of unease and psychological tension.
